Current Research Interests and Capability
- Electromagnetic numerical modelling using conformal and dispersive FDTD methods
- Microwave metamaterials and their applications
- Antennas and Radio Propagation for Body-Centric Wireless Communications
- Millimeter wave and THz Antennas
- Photonic Antennas for Radio Fibre Technologies
- Applications of carbon nanotubes and graphene
Research Funding
Current studies are funded by EPSRC, TSB, Leverhulme Trust, Royal Society, and industries including BAE Systems, Office of Navel Research Global and DSTL etc.
